How on-demand rewards work in the Instant model
Stradger describes on-demand rewards as the ability to request rewards without waiting for a fixed reward date, once requirements are met. In the Instant model:
- When you reach 5% profit, you can move earnings to your wallet and request a reward.
- If profit is below 5%, you can still withdraw a performance reward after 14 days from the start of your trading cycle.
This structure can benefit traders who prefer flexibility and control, especially if they trade opportunistically or want to sync withdrawals with personal budgeting.
Risk Framework and Leverage: Clear Limits That Encourage Discipline
Leverage up to 1:30
Stradger offers leverage up to 1:30. For many strategies, this provides enough flexibility to manage position sizing efficiently—especially when combined with a strict risk plan.
Dynamic max-loss with trailing logic
Stradger describes a dynamic Max Loss mechanism that adjusts based on your highest closed balance. As profits grow, the Max Loss level can rise accordingly, but only up to your initial balance. Once it moves up, it remains locked at that level even if your balance later decreases.
For traders, the benefit is two-fold:
- It can help protect progress as you build closed profits.
- It reinforces the habit of locking in performance rather than giving it back through oversized drawdowns.

Trade Rules: Weekend and News Policies (Know Them Before You Start)
Rules are only frustrating when they’re unclear. When they’re clear, they become a performance framework you can plan around. Stradger outlines distinct conditions depending on the model:
- Step Challenges (Evaluation): Weekend holding is allowed.
- Step Master: Weekend holding is allowed, but profits may be capped if within 5 minutes of high-impact news.
- Instant Challenges: News and weekend trading are strictly prohibited.
The upside here is predictability: you can choose the Challenge type that matches your strategy. If your edge relies on weekend gaps or trading news spikes, a Step-based path may align better than Instant.
